Quick Summary

The Department of the Navy, specifically NAVFACSYSCOM SOUTHEAST, has issued a Solicitation for the P215 Joint Interagency Task Force - South (JIATF-S) Command and Control Facility project. This opportunity involves the construction of an administrative facility at Truman Annex, Naval Air Station (NAS) Key West, FL. The response deadline is March 10, 2026.

Scope of Work

This solicitation is for the construction of the P215 Joint Interagency Task Force - South (JIATF-S) Command and Control Facility. The project falls under Product Service Code Y1AZ, indicating Construction Of Other Administrative Facilities And Service Buildings.
